Portsmouth nightclub blaze sees 1,000 clubbers evacuated

About 1,000 clubbers were evacuated after a fire broke out at a nightclub in Portsmouth.
The fire started in the ceiling above the dance floor at The Astoria, Guildhall Walk, at about 01:40 BST during its mid-week dirty disco event.
Police and door staff helped clubbers out of the three-storey building while fire crews put out the blaze. No-one was hurt.
The club said it would open at midday for people to collect their belongings.
The event is described on the venue's Facebook page as "probably the best mid-week club night in Portsmouth" featuring "stilt walkers and fire breathers."
Following the incident, the club posted: "Once again, thank you for everyone's assistance and patience."
Hampshire Fire and Rescue Service said the fire was believed to have started in ducting in a ceiling void above the dance floor.
